Lingala Aravind Goud S/O. Late Guru Lingam, v. The State Of Telangana, Rep By Its Principal Secretary,
HON'BLE SRI JUSTICE A.RAJASHEKER REDDY WRIT PETITION No.4434 OF 2017 ORDER:
The case of the petitioner is that their family owns vast extents of land in and around Kondamadugu Village, Bibi Nagar Mandal, Nalgonda District in Survey Nos.597, 606, 607, 612, 618, 619, 620, 621, 628, 629 and 630 and that these lands are his ancestral properties and were recorded in the name of petitioner's father Lingala Guru Lingam Goud and they have got lawful share in the same. While so, the petitioner applied for grant of succession in his favour for all properties including the subject lands after the death of his father who died on 14.01.2006, and they also filed necessary affidavit before the 3rd respondent. During such period, they came to know that the revenue records were in respect of subject land were altered by entering the name of the 4th respondent in place of petitioner's father. Aggrieved by the same, present writ petition is filed.
Heard learned counsel for the petitioner and learned Assistant Government Pleader for Revenue.
The petitioner has not mentioned in the affidavit the extent of lands owned by him or his father and no date is mentioned as to when he applied for grant of succession. It is also not clear that as to when the entries in the revenue
records were altered. In view of the same, I do not see any reason to entertain the writ petition.
Accordingly, the writ petition is dismissed. However it is open for the petitioner to seek appropriate remedy for correction of entries in the revenue records and also for grant of succession for mutation of their names. No order as to costs.
